During Safeway’s Monopoly game event (from Feb. 8 to May 9), Julie Balzan managed to collect the big winning tickets.
According to the manager of the Safeway in Wheatland, Cody Halliwell, the prize awarded was the biggest monetary prize the store was offering.
After needing to have the winning tickets verified by the corporate office, Balzan was able to collect her winnings on Monday.
Balzan has requested the amount of her winnings not be announced.
